We've got an SMF board ( 2.0.15 ) we've had running for a year or so ( migrated from Snitz early '17 ), but we've got a problem with permissions on a board.

Long story short, our admins are very strict about off topic posts, but in the interest of trying to find a place for users to have some more headroom for discussion, I created a board ( called "Around the Campfire...") that was only accessible by one group ( other than admins ), which I called "OT_users", which is empty for now.

I tested access with two user accounts that are normal members and was unable to see the board, so I assumed it was invisible to everyone. A few days ago, members who I believed to have no access to it started posting in what I thought was an inaccessible board.

I've double checked with my test accounts, they have no access. I've checked the account of one of the members that's posting in the board and the board shows up as restricted ( screenshot attached ).

I'm baffled and don't know what to change or where to look for how they're getting through. Our forum (Trek Tracks ) is for owners of a relatively obscure brand of RV's and most of our owners are older and not terribly tech-savvy, plus the guys who are posting in the board are good guys - I'm really sure they're not hacking their way into our system.

Any suggestions about where to look or what to change?

I got this one figured out. Turns out,  for some reason, some of my admins have been taking OT topics and moving them here, rather than deleting them as they've always done before. This is despite my asking them to leave this board alone.

Mystery solved. Thanks again, anyone that read this.
